## Runbook: Gaugepile Sidecar — Release Checklist

Heads up: the sidecar ships with every app pod, so a bad config fans out fast. Before cutting a release, confirm the flush interval hasn't drifted from what the Tallyhouse aggregator expects, or you'll see sawtooth gaps in dashboards. Rollbacks are cheap — just repin the image tag. Canary one node pool first, watch for ten minutes, then proceed. The values to verify against are these.

config for bagep-yafof:
quenath:
  pin: 8584
  metrics_host: metrics.quenath.tolvaqsys.internal
  tenant: pelath
  seal: seal_ed102645

Off-site run, item 7: museum labels for the new Fernbrook Gallery at the Withervale Institute. Three flat boxes, clearly marked, waiting on the dispatch shelf nearest the roller door. Contents are printed label panels and mounting strips — keep flat, do not stack anything on top. Delivery window is Thursday before noon, as installers are booked that afternoon. Confirm the box count with the driver at loading. The courier hand-over instruction appears on the line below.

handover note for yagef-bagep: the drudor pelius courier leaves the kasdor zorvan norir ledger at gate 8016 under passcode 755406

Plugin authors publishing to the Larkmoor build grid occasionally see signature-validation failures caused by clock skew between agents. If an agent's clock drifts more than 90 seconds from the coordinator, timestamps on provenance attestations fall outside the acceptance window and uploads are rejected. Before filing a support ticket, run the grid's time-check utility on the failing agent and restart its sync daemon if drift exceeds the threshold. When reporting a persistent failure, include the coordinator trace token shown below.

pipeline stamp: htk9_ce63042d9

Quick context for newcomers: during the Brinley Heights outage, our greedy assignment loop kept handing long-haul jobs to drivers already near shift end, cascading into a pile of reassignments. We're adding explicit penalty weights so the heuristic actually respects shift buffers and proximity instead of pure ETA. Owner is the dispatch pod; target is next sprint. Please don't hand-tune these in prod — change them via config review. The weights we're starting from are shown below.

constants for kageg-bawif:
QUOTAS = {
    "quenwyn": 1,
    "oliix": 10,
}